How to Write the Perfect Job Description and Requirements for Your Job Post


When it comes to attracting the right candidates for your job opening, a well-written job description and clear job requirements are essential. These vital components will not only help you find the most qualified individuals but also save time in the hiring process. In this blog post, we will guide you on how to craft the perfect job description and requirements that will attract top talent to your company.

Section 1: Crafting an Engaging Job Description

Transitioning from an average job description to an attention-grabbing one involves highlighting the key aspects that make your company and the role unique. When writing your job description, keep these tips in mind:

  • Be Specific: Clearly outline the job title, department, and responsibilities. Avoid using vague terms and jargon that may confuse potential candidates.
  • Showcase Company Culture: Describe your company’s values, mission, and work environment. This helps candidates understand the values they’ll be working for and if they align with their own.
  • Highlight Benefits and Perks: Emphasize any unique benefits or perks your company offers, such as flexible work hours, remote work options, or professional development opportunities.

Section 2: Defining Job Requirements

Well-defined job requirements are crucial for attracting candidates with the right qualifications. Follow these tips to create effective requirements:

  • Set Clear Expectations: Clearly outline the necessary skills, experience, and education for the position. This helps candidates determine if they meet the requirements and saves time for both parties.
  • Focus on Key Skills: Identify the essential skills and qualifications required to excel in the role. Prioritize these skills in your job requirements to ensure the right candidates apply.
  • Keep it Realistic: Avoid setting unrealistic expectations that may deter potential candidates. Strike a balance between the necessary qualifications and room for growth.


By crafting an engaging job description and defining clear job requirements, you can attract the most qualified candidates to your company. Remember to be specific, highlight your company culture and benefits, and set realistic expectations. These steps will not only help you find the perfect fit for your team but also save time in the hiring process.